He was head coach of the Japanese basketball team that qualified for the 2019 World Cup in the People's Republic of China. It was the first time Japan had secured a spot for the tournament [without qualifying as hosts] since 1998. (basquetplus.com, 24 Feb 2019)

He was head coach of the Argentina men's basketball team that won gold at the 2011 AmeriCup in Argentina and bronze at the 2013 AmeriCup in Venezuela. (fiba.basketball, 12 Sep 2013, 12 Sep 2011)

He was assistant coach of the Argentina men's basketball team that won bronze at the 2008 Olympic Games in Beijing. (usabasketball.com, 31 Mar 2010)

He has led club teams to five Argentine Pro League Championships, one South American League, a Spanish second division league championship and Spanish second division Cup. (clubenhur.com.abr, 29 Aug 2019; telam.com.ar, 17 Jul 2019; usabasketball.com, 31 May 2010)
:
He is a six-time National Coach of the Year in Argentina. (usabasketball.com, 31 Mar 2010)

He was assistant coach of the Argentina men's basketball team before being appointed head coach in 2010. At club level he has coached Tau Ceramica, Lucentum Alicante, and Real Madrid in Spain, as well as Boca Juniors, Ben Hur, Obras Sanitarias, San Lorenzo, and Libertad de Sunchales in Argentina. He has also served as the Argentinian U22 men's basketball team coach.
